Hello everyone.

I have 2 norinco's and unfortunately both are missing the barrel threads and bayo lugs (WAY TO GO LIBS). I believe I can thread the barrels for a brake or flash suppressor. What are the options for a 14x1 left hand thread? Just the slant? Would there be more and better options for a different thread? The die is a bit expensive for the 14x1.

Also I would like to restore the bayo lug. Is there a way a garage tinkerer could do it. I can not weld though. Can the sight base be replaced?

Last  I would like my cleaning rod mount(?) restored. If a new sight base with bayo mount could be put on that would take care of the front, but how could I get the middle mount that the rod goes thru fixed, it was completely machined off by norinco.

By the way I can understand the bayo lug being cut off because of the law, but why the cleaning rod mounts?! I never understood that, others makes have their cleaning rods.

I just want to get my ak "look" back from the anti-gunners.

Any help would be appreciated1

Your in the back of a very very long line of people who want Chinese gas blocks with bayonet lugs and Chinese front sight posts with the cleanig rod holder and Chinese handguard retainers with the hole and Chinese wood furniture with the pistol grip. I believe that as far as AK imports go, more MAK 90 rifles are in the US than any other AK varient. Once the libs told people they were no longer going to be able to have these types of guns people went nuts and average Joes that didn't know squat about guns found themselves buying "assault rifles". If you want them I know of 1 place you can get their only set for $250. Wow that's expensive eh? Yeah well supply vs demand pal. Then you'd need a smith to do it and would need to reblue to look finished. Well total theres the price of a used preban Chinese AK, imagine that. Otherwise your only choice is to put other foreign parts on it. If you want the look to be authentic this won't do. If you just want the part to be there then some other countries parts will fit. I'm not sure which ones though. Probably could be found for $50 or so. I too have been looking for a long time man.

Whynot pick up a Polytech barrel assembly from Polytechparts.com and strip the barrel for the handguard retainer, gas block with rod loop, front sight base assy. with cleaning rod retainer, and swap the parts out? It will use a generation 1 bayo. They also have the wood except the pistol grips.Madtechcool
